Cinema Paradiso (Italian: Nuovo Cinema Paradiso, "New Paradise Cinema") is a 1988 Italian drama film written and directed by Giuseppe Tornatore. The plot of Cinema Paradiso is loosely based on the story of the Protti family, who have owned a movie theatre in Mantua, Italy, since 1904.
